Trump tours La. flood damage, draws cheers as he says region will rebuild | 19 Aug 2016 | Donald Trump landed Friday in flood-ravaged Louisiana Friday, where he consoled homeowners and toured devastated communities, telling one homeowner he is “going to rebuild.” The Republican presidential nominee, with running mate Mike Pence at his side, stopped at the home of Jimmy and Olive Gordan in Denham Springs, where the couple was still sweeping out floodwaters from their home. A ruined couch, chair and bedroom furniture were piled on their lawn, and Jimmy Gordan told Trump he spent his 79th birthday on the roof of his house.”I just don't know what we'll do,” the man told Trump. “You're going to rebuild,” Trump told him as the two hugged. “It's going to be so beautiful.”
